Click to reveal the answerThe answer is: man, or red earth
Genesis 2:7 - The name "Adam" derives from the Hebrew word "adamah," meaning "red earth" or "ground." This reflects the biblical account of creation, where God formed Adam from the dust of the earth, highlighting humanity's connection to creation (Genesis 1:26-27).
